目的:探讨0.9%氯化钠溶液在42℃保温箱中的保存期限及成本分析。方法选择80瓶0.9%氯化钠溶液作为研究对象,使用统计软件SAS 9.2随机分成对照组和保温组,每组各40瓶,对照组置于层流洁净手术室室温下,保温组置于42℃保温箱中。各组分别于5个时间点(实验开始后3 d、1周、2周、3周、4周)各取8瓶检测其细菌培养的菌落数和pH值的变化。在前期实验的基础上随后选取12个手术间,随机分为A组和B组,各6个手术间。 A组由保温箱A供应温0.9%氯化钠溶液,保存期限3 d;B组由保温箱B供应温0.9%氯化钠溶液,保存期限4周。结果两组0.9%氯化钠溶液细菌培养均为阴性。对照组5个时间点pH值分别为(6.35±0.29),(6.32±0.04),(6.23±0.20),(6.29±0.35),(6.36±0.32);保温组5个时间点pH值分别为(6.37±0.42),(6.31±0.11),(6.39±0.21),(6.42±0.45),(6.60±0.32),两组同一时间点pH值差异无统计学意义(t值分别为0.1108,0.2417,1.5610,0.6450,2.1110;P >0.05)。 A 组0.9%氯化钠溶液消耗量为(2761±118)瓶,成本为(11042±470)元,B组消耗量为(1466±205)瓶,成本为(5862±820)元,两组比较差异均有统计学意义(t=13.41;P<0.01)。结论0.9%氯化钠溶液在42℃保温箱中的保存期限可延长至4周,检测指标符合药典要求,可降低其用量并节约成本。

Objective To explore the storage life and cost analysis of 0. 9% sodium chloride solution in 42℃ conveuse. Methods A total of 80 bottles of 0. 9% sodium chloride solution had been selected as research sampling, and the SAS 9. 2 were used to randomly divide them into control group (put sampling in clean laminar flow operation room at room temperature) and experimental group ( put in 42℃ conveuse) on average. Eight bottles of each group were took out for the number of colony examination after germiculture and the change of pH value ( at the beginning of 3 days, 1 week, 2 weeks, 3 weeks and 4 weeks experiment) . Basis on the previous experiment, we selected 12 operating room and randomly divided into A group and B group on average. A conveuse provided warm 0. 9% sodium chloride solution, which had three days storage life in A group, but B conveuse offered warm 0. 9% sodium chloride solution of 4 weeks storage life. Results The results of germiculture were negative in both group. The 5 time point of pH values were (6. 35 ± 0. 29), (6. 32 ± 0. 04), (6. 23 ± 0. 20), (6. 29 ± 0. 35), (6. 36 ± 0. 32) at the control group, while these of experimental group were (6.37 ±0.42), (6.31 ±0.11), (6.39 ±0.21), (6.42 ±0.45), (6.60 ±0.32)and at the same time point the pH value of two groups had no statistical significance (t=0. 110 8, 0. 241 7, 1. 561 0, 0. 645 0, 2. 111 0;P>0. 05). Compared with A group-consumed (2 761 ± 118) bottles, cost (11 042 ± 470) Yuan, B group consumed (1 466 ± 205) bottles and cost (5 862 ± 820) Yuan with statistical significance between two groups (t=13.41;P<0.01).Conclusions Thepreservationof0.9% sodiumchloridesolutionin42℃ conveusecan be maintained 4 weeks and reduced cost by the decreasing the number of usage, and the testing norm is accord with the acquirement of pharmacopeia.
